What are some common challenges faced by legal professionals working at a large law firm like Covington & Burling, and how can new hires prepare for them?

Legal professionals at large firms such as Covington & Burling often encounter challenges like managing heavy workloads, balancing multiple high-stakes cases or clients, and adapting quickly to fast-paced environments. New hires can prepare by developing strong organizational and time-management skills, proactively seeking feedback from senior team members, and staying current on industry trends and legal developments. Collaboration and effective communication are also crucial, as teams at large firms often work cross-functionally to deliver comprehensive solutions to clients.

What is a Covington?

Covington jobs typically refer to employment opportunities at Covington & Burling LLP, a major international law firm known simply as 'Covington.' These jobs include roles for lawyers, paralegals, legal assistants, and various administrative, IT, and support staff. Working at Covington means being part of a team that handles high-profile legal cases and provides counsel to clients in areas such as litigation, corporate law, intellectual property, and regulatory matters. The firm is recognized for its commitment to professional development, diversity, and a collaborative work environment. Applicants usually need strong academic backgrounds and a commitment to excellence.
